The Benefits of Multichannel Retail Management Software
Investing in multichannel management tools offers several advantages:
- Streamlined Operations: By consolidating various sales channels, retailers can manage inventory, process orders, and track customer interactions more effectively.
- Enhanced Customer Experience: Providing customers with a coherent shopping journey, whether online or offline, is crucial for retaining loyalty.
- Data-Driven Insights: This software enables retailers to analyze consumer behavior and market trends, allowing for informed strategic decisions.
- Cost Reduction: By optimizing processes, businesses can cut unnecessary expenses and improve their bottom line.

Challenges to Consider
Despite the benefits, retailers may face challenges in implementing multichannel retail management software:
- Integration Issues: Consolidating existing systems can be complex, requiring time and resources.
- Resistance to Change: Employees may be hesitant to adopt new technologies, necessitating change management strategies.
- Cost of Implementation: Initial investment in technology may be a barrier for smaller retailers.
Retailers need to carefully evaluate these challenges and weigh them against the substantial benefits of adopting multichannel retail management solutions.
